Exploratory Dive & Mangrove/Seagrass Meadows Snorkeling

This morning we met with our advisors for our independent research project for the semester to talk about our interests. After our meeting, we went on an exploratory dive to look more closely at the interest that we expressed in our meeting. I think I am going to do something on sea anemones but need to do some research to see what question I want to ask.

This afternoon we snorkeled in Lac Baii around the mangroves and seagrass meadows. The visibility was low but still saw some interesting things. Saw a bunch of juvenile fish species, a little barracuda, and a Queen conch (which are illegal to catch here on Bonaire, but people still poach them).
